Output e7603992158aefd10704ade4af36c3015f3d8ba45765a911078a00e437216666:1

value
22394
script pubkey
OP_0 OP_PUSHBYTES_20 bb509d7677c5d601994c33a4b7e1886737851f7e
address
ltc1qhdgf6anhchtqrx2vxwjt0cvgvumc28m7txq4cp
transaction
e7603992158aefd10704ade4af36c3015f3d8ba45765a911078a00e437216666
spent
true